How to become a wedding planner assistant?

The qualifications to become a wedding planner assistant include a high school diploma or G.E.D. certificate. An associate or bachelor’s degree in hospitality or event planning may improve your job prospects. Certification from a professional organization such as the American Association of Certified Wedding Planners or the Wedding Planning Institute can also help you begin your career. Skills developed in the hospitality industry can certainly help you qualify for a job. If you lack job experience, you may be able to find a wedding planner who is willing to teach you the basics when it comes to applicable job duties, like interacting with and assisting the bride and groom.

What is the difference between Assistant Wedding Planner vs Wedding Coordinator?

AspectAssistant Wedding PlannerWedding Coordinator
ResponsibilitiesSupports planning tasks, vendor communication, logisticsManages day-of coordination, ensures event runs smoothly
CredentialsOften entry-level, some certifications helpfulExperience in event planning, sometimes certifications
Work EnvironmentAssists during planning phase, office and event sitesOn-site during wedding day, overseeing execution
Employer & Industry UsageEvent planning companies, wedding plannersWedding venues, event planning firms

While both roles support wedding events, an Assistant Wedding Planner primarily assists with planning and vendor coordination, whereas a Wedding Coordinator focuses on managing the event on the wedding day itself. The assistant helps prepare, while the coordinator ensures everything runs smoothly during the event.

What are some common challenges faced by assistant wedding planners, and how can they be overcome?

Assistant Wedding Planners often face the challenge of juggling multiple tasks simultaneously, such as coordinating with vendors, managing timelines, and addressing last-minute changes. To overcome these challenges, strong organizational skills and effective communication are essential. Proactively anticipating issues, maintaining detailed checklists, and being adaptable under pressure can help ensure events run smoothly. Additionally, building good relationships with both clients and vendors fosters collaboration and streamlines problem-solving on the big day.

What does an assistant wedding planner do?

An Assistant Wedding Planner supports the lead wedding planner in organizing and executing weddings. Their responsibilities may include coordinating with vendors, managing timelines, assisting with guest lists, setting up venues, and handling last-minute issues on the wedding day. They help ensure all details are in place so the event runs smoothly and the couple can enjoy their special day. This role is ideal for those who are organized, detail-oriented, and enjoy working in a fast-paced environment.

Banquet Server
Walters Wedding Estates
We are currently seeking enthusiastic and professional Banquet Servers to join our team. As a Banquet Server,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the success of weddings and events by providing top-notch service to our clients and their guests. This position is ideal for individuals who thrive in a fast-paced, customer-focused environment and have a passion for creating memorable experiences. This position reports directly to the Operations Manager.
What You'll Do:
  • Set up banquet areas, including moving tables and chairs, according to event specifications on the BEO
  • Greet and assist guests in a friendly and professional manner.
  • Serve food, plated and buffet, and beverages, ensuring a high level of customer satisfaction.
  • Respond promptly to guest requests and anticipate their needs.
  • Maintain a clean and organized event space throughout the event.
  • Execute closing duties, including but not limited to clearing tables, breaking down banquet areas, and storing equipment.
  • Work closely with the culinary and planning team to ensure seamless execution.
  • Collaborate with fellow servers to provide efficient and attentive service.

Qualifications:
  • Experience: At least 1 year in a similar role with comparable responsibilities preferred
  • Education: Applicable Work History, TABC, and Food Handlers license required in Texas
  • Physical: Able to lift 30 lbs frequently, stand/walk 8-12 hours
  • Other:
    • Submit/complete background check; have a valid driver's license and reliable transportation
    • Must be eligible to work in the United States; Walters Hospitality participates in E-Verify.

Compensation & Schedule:
  • Part-time work required on weekends and when events take place.
  • 401k plan with a 4% Match

Location: Ashton Gardens West
